Episode 41 : Matt Giordano on feeling better in your yoga practice
In this episode Matt and I chat over how years of using and abusing his body eventually led him to yoga where he explored his curiosity for understanding his unique path to feeling better.
About Matt
Yoga instructor Matt Giordano gives credit to an influential figure from his teenage years – his high school art teacher – for sparking within him the curiosity and tenacity that eventually led him to yoga. It was Eileen Walk who told Giordano, “You are not allowed to say ‘I can’t.’ You must rephrase to a question: ‘How?'”
That inquisitive and unrelenting spirit laid the foundation for Matt to begin a devoted yoga practice. When coupled with his passion to understand the physics and subtle alignment of the body, Matt’s dharma as a teacher came into focus.
Originally from Sea Cliff, Long Island, Giordano spent 7 years developing his teaching style while living in Manhattan, where he taught at local studios (Pure NYC, Equinox). Matt now travels internationally to teach his signature technique-based style of yoga, educating yoga students on how to use their bodies in a profound and life-changing way. Well known for his ability to guide students deeply into postures with his refined attention to detail and precise action cues, Giordano is an adept guide for students of all levels at festivals, workshops, and in his weekly studio classes. His study of biomechanics and integrative mind-body techniques informs his teaching, as he draws upon wisdom from traditions of yoga, martial arts (Aikido and Tae Kwon Do), acrobatics, AcroYoga, and Thai Yoga Massage. Matt is known to inspire humble confidence, allowing students to find ease while expanding the edge of their comfort zones.
In 2016, Matt created and founded an international school of yoga that focuses on community, growth and authentic teaching, and he hosts trainings each year out of his home in northwest Connecticut.

Episode 38 (part 2): The Neurology of Headaches - Dr. Eric Cobb
Welcome to part 2 of episode 38 on the “Love at First Science'' Podcast where Dr. Eric Cobb dives into the neuroscience of headaches!
Are you struggling with headaches on a regular basis? Dr. Cobb is back on the podcast to talk about the holistic way to approach headaches and why medication isn’t always the best solution. He introduces the different kinds of headaches and shares the difference between symptom control versus using different perspectives for treatment. He explains the anatomy that is connected to headaches and presents his treatment plan. Dr. Cobb talks about the three topics that influence headaches: diet, sleep, and water intake. He shares the role of movement, and he discusses why there is so much controversy about moving the body when feeling pain and especially headaches. He also talks about the importance of self-awareness and how listening to your body can change the perspective on pain. He describes the way massaging the head has an influence on headaches and he explains the role of using vision and vestibular drills to reduce the pain.
Learn More About Dr. Cobb:
Dr. Eric Cobb completed his chiropractic degree (magna cum laude) at the University of Western States in 1994. In 2003, he founded Z-Health Performance – a company that specializes in innovating advanced, neurologically-centered rehabilitative and sports performance programs based on emerging research. He and his team train fitness coaches, athletic coaches, therapists and physicians from all over the world. Dr. Cobb is passionate about blending emerging research with established protocols in an effort to provide practitioners with cutting-edge strategies aimed at maximizing training outcomes. With over 4,000 certified Z-Health professionals around the world, Dr. Cobb’s goal is to bring a neurocentric viewpoint into every clinic, gym and training facility. In addition to his teaching schedule, Dr. Cobb regularly consults with clients ranging from weekend athletes to international caliber competitors in a variety of sports. He is a life-long martial artist and combatives trainer with deep ties to the military and law enforcement communities where he provides consulting and hands-on training to increase fitness and performance for specialized units.

Episode 37 (part 2): How vascular health is impacting your headaches - Dr Perry Nickelston
Welcome to part 2 of episode 37 on the “Love at First Science'' Podcast where Dr Perry Nickelston dives into how vascular health impacts headaches.
Do you want to know how you can influence your pain perception by simply rubbing your collar bone? Dr. Perry is back on the podcast talking about headaches and jaw pain. He is an expert on the lymphatic system, and he shares how powerful it is with treating pain. He describes how pain works in the body and how everything is deeply connected. He explains the pain’s request for change and how this form of protection is often not located at the place we originally feel it in the body. On the podcast he discusses the journey to find the actual source(s) of the pain. He talks about the role of the lymph and shares the steps of his treatment plan. He describes what it is exposed to every day and how important it is to listen to and observe the body. He clarifies why headaches and jaw pain are usually noticed so quickly. Dr. Perry shares his treatment approach about the effect of touch and explains the role of the collar bone.
Learn More About Dr. Perry:
Perry Nickelston, DC aka ‘The Lymph Doc’ is a Chiropractic Physician with a primary focus on treating chronic pain and inflammation via the lymphatic and vascular systems. Owner of Stop Chasing Pain, LLC. International speaker and educator of the self-care MOJO series. Lymphatic Mojo, Blood Flow Mojo, Tongue Mojo, Glymphatic Mojo, Visceral Mojo, Vagus Nerve Mojo, Primal Movement Mojo.
Author of the upcoming book Stop Chasing Pain: A vital guide to healing your body, moving well, and gaining control of your life. Dr. Perry specializes in Performance Enhancement, Corrective Exercise, and Metabolic Fitness Nutrition and is trained from The American College of Addictionology and Compulsive Disorders. He is an expert in myofascial, orthopedic, medical and trigger point soft tissue therapy. A member of the Board of Directors and Medical Staff Advisor for AIMLA (American Institute of Medical Laser Application).
Dr. Perry is an expert in movement assessment and diagnosis. Certified and trained as a Functional Movement Specialist (FMS) and Selective Functional Movement Assessment Specialist (SFMA). He uses programs designed to find sources of non-painful dysfunction so your site of pain improves.A regular columnist for Dynamic Chiropractic, Practice Insights, Chiropractic Economics, To Your Health Magazine, Advance Physical Therapy, PT on the Net, LiveStrong, StrengthCoach, and other industry publications for health and fitness.
After healing from a severe back injury and autoimmune disease he decided to dedicate himself to offering these self-care approaches to others. Designer of the Body Ecosystem Hierarchy is a self-treatment program whose sole purpose is to empower you to regain control of your life from chronic pain.
He is a 1997 graduate of Palmer Chiropractic University and a master fitness trainer with over 25 years of experience in the health industry.

Episode 36 (part 2): The spinal Cord - it’s more than you could ever imagine with Mike Golden
Welcome to part 2 of episode 36 on the “Love at First Science'' Podcast where Mike Golden about the spinal cord as it is more than you could ever imagine.
Mike Golden is back on the podcast explaining more about the spinal cord. He starts by talking about his journey in personal training and coaching and being a part of Z-health. He loves breaking down difficult topics to make it accessible to everyone. He shares how the Z-health program on the brain and nervous system is divided into smaller parts to make learning easier. In the model the knowledge is translated into simple steps. In addition, he precisely explains what the spinal cord is. He talks about the way that it is built and the function behind it. He discusses the importance of the pathways and briefly explains what they are capable of. He also talks about visual or auditive activation, and what effect they have on treating pain. During his work he has realized that neuro anatomy should be a bigger part of the general knowledge about the body and should be accessible to many people.
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Learn More About Mike Golden:
Mike Golden is the Director of Education for Z-Health Performance Solutions, a world leader in innovating advanced, neurologically-centered rehabilitative and sports performance programs based on emerging research. Mike received his undergraduate degree from Dartmouth College in 2005 before beginning his career teaching martial arts full time and using brain-based training to fast-track his clients’ pain and performance successes. Over the course of two decades, he has relentlessly pursued professional development through the Z-Health curriculum and in the broader fields of fitness, functional neurology, and pedagogy, and he has been leading national and international certification courses for Z-Health since 2013.

Episode 35 (part 2): "The brain is in charge" with Tony Rhine
Welcome to part 1 of episode 35 on the “Love at First Science'' Podcast where Tony Rhine speaks into how the brain is in charge of every kind of output whether it be sensation, feeling, thoughts or behavior.
The connection between pain in your body and the function of the brain is deeply connected. In this podcast Tony Rhine brings some insight into the brain’s way of functioning and how to work with it to improve pain or performance. Chronic pain gave Tony the desire to try to understand its true origin. With this as a foundation started using Z-health which taught him about neuroscience and the science behind pain and the nervous system’s function. His work is centered on the person and highly personalised. In this chat Tony will share more about the visual and vestibular component of the brain, and how these systems increase performance and can improve people’s lives.
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Learn More About Tony Rhine:
Tony Rhine is incredibly passionate about helping people be the best version of themselves. He has worked in the training and rehabilitation field since 2010 and has worked with a myriad of different populations. From experience with rehabilitation of PTSD, ADD, Autism, chronic pain, and other complex issues to training professional athletes in various sports, Tony has extensive experience in taking people from their worst physical state to their best. Tony has worked alongside various Doctors, Physical Therapists, Chiropractors, and other Medical professionals as a primary referral to assist them with their most complex patients.
In addition to running Tony Rhine NeuroAthletic Training, He was formerly the Education Advisor for Z-Health Education, the global leader in neurocentric education for health and fitness professionals. He is a Master Practitioner Candidate with Z-Health and has taken over 400 hours of their coursework for continuing education in the field of applied neurology.
